1.组织架构模块代码。
代码中包括创建部门类、员工类和组织架构类,以及实现了一些数据库连接的功能。
```cpp
#include <QSqlDatabase>
#include <QSqlQuery>
// 部门类
class Department {
public:
Department(int id, QString name)
: m_id(id), m_name(name) {}
int id() const { return m_id; }
QString name() const { return m_name; }
private:
int m_id;
QString m_name;
};
// 员工类
class Employee {
public:
Employee(int id, QString name, int age, QString gender, int departmentId)
: m_id(id), m_name(name), m_age(age), m_gender(gender), m_departmentId(departmentId) {}
int id() const { return m_id; }
QString name() const {